Transaction aef6bf102809fee3a029b81da55db9089c93410626d5b69b4f4db6866c95a288
2 Input
2 Outputs
- aef6bf102809fee3a029b81da55db9089c93410626d5b69b4f4db6866c95a288:0
- aef6bf102809fee3a029b81da55db9089c93410626d5b69b4f4db6866c95a288:1
value 1985129
address 1BMnaJXcaU6z5M5LQf7WmjHAhSMxGpAZdL
value 32822750
address 3NzzSxLGcBU6zmgLu7G4WBetXeMJgbPhcf